* Fits COAMFT, COACRE, and CSWE requirements for social and cultural diversity * Addresses a cutting-edge question that spans across theory, training, and clinical practice: "How can practitioners integrate awareness of societal systems across models into their everyday work with individuals, couples and families?" * Applies a sociocultural perspective to a variety of evidence-based and historically effective practice models to address a plethora of emotional, psychological, and relational problems. * Bridges theory and practice * Authors are the leaders in the field of socioculturally attuned family therapy * New edition integrates current trends as well as cultural and societal change, such as the BLM movement, LGBTQ issues, and the Trump presidency. * Includes more diverse voices that describe the creative application of this framework in practice. This is presented using key text boxes throughout the text. * New edition includes how the authors have moved their thinking forward with regards to the framework, such as third-order thinking as a paradigm shift in the field of family therapy, ethics as infused in everyday practice from a third-order perspective, and the limits and applicability of Socioculturally Attuned Family Therapy as a transtheoretical, transnational approach. * Includes reflective questions at the end of each chapter. * Includes a new chapter on socio-emotional relational therapy and how this relates to SCARFT Applies a sociocultural perspective to a variety of evidence-based and historically effective practice models to address a plethora of emotional, psychological and relational problems.
